Setting the Stage: A Clash of Titans
The Lakers, led by the ageless LeBron James and the dominant Anthony Davis, come into this series with a wealth of playoff experience and a hunger to prove they are still a force to be reckoned with in the West. After navigating the play-in tournament, they're battle-tested and ready for the challenge. Their journey to this point has been anything but easy, facing tough opponents and overcoming adversity, which has only strengthened their resolve and camaraderie. The Lakers' playoff experience is a significant advantage, as LeBron James, with his extensive postseason resume, knows exactly what it takes to win in high-pressure situations. Anthony Davis, when healthy and engaged, is a game-changer on both ends of the court, capable of shutting down opposing offenses and scoring at will. The Lakers' supporting cast, including players like D'Angelo Russell and Austin Reaves, have shown flashes of brilliance throughout the season and will need to step up their game even further to complement their star duo. Their ability to perform consistently and make crucial plays in key moments will be pivotal to the Lakers' success in this series. Moreover, the Lakers' coaching staff has been meticulously studying the Timberwolves, identifying their strengths and weaknesses, and devising strategies to exploit them. They understand that every possession matters in the playoffs, and they will leave no stone unturned in their quest to gain an edge over their opponents. The Lakers' preparation and attention to detail, combined with their star power and playoff experience, make them a formidable team to beat.
On the other side, the Timberwolves, spearheaded by the explosive Anthony Edwards and the versatile Karl-Anthony Towns, are eager to make a statement and show the league that they are a team on the rise. They’ve had a great regular season and are looking to translate that success into the playoffs. Their journey to this point has been marked by impressive victories and a growing sense of confidence. Anthony Edwards has emerged as a true superstar, capable of taking over games with his scoring prowess and athleticism. Karl-Anthony Towns, when healthy and in rhythm, provides a formidable inside presence and a reliable scoring option. The Timberwolves' supporting cast, including players like Jaden McDaniels and Mike Conley, have played crucial roles in their success, contributing on both ends of the court. Their ability to defend effectively and knock down open shots will be essential to the Timberwolves' chances of upsetting the Lakers. The Timberwolves' coaching staff has instilled a strong sense of belief and determination in their players, emphasizing the importance of teamwork and resilience. They understand that the playoffs are a different beast altogether, and they will need to execute their game plan flawlessly to overcome the Lakers' experience and star power. The Timberwolves' youth and athleticism, combined with their rising stars and unwavering confidence, make them a dangerous opponent that the Lakers cannot afford to underestimate.
Key Matchups to Watch
- 
LeBron James vs. Jaden McDaniels: This will be a fascinating battle. Can McDaniels contain LeBron’s drives and limit his playmaking? LeBron's ability to exploit mismatches and create opportunities for his teammates is well-known, but McDaniels' defensive prowess and athleticism could pose a challenge. McDaniels' length and agility will be crucial in disrupting LeBron's rhythm and forcing him into tough shots. However, LeBron's experience and basketball IQ will be invaluable in finding ways to overcome McDaniels' defense. This matchup will be a test of both skill and strategy, as each player seeks to gain an advantage over the other. 
- 
Anthony Davis vs. Karl-Anthony Towns: AD’s defensive presence and scoring ability against KAT’s offensive versatility will be pivotal. Davis's shot-blocking and rebounding will be crucial in limiting Towns' impact on the boards and preventing second-chance opportunities for the Timberwolves. Towns' ability to stretch the floor with his shooting will test Davis's defensive range and require him to be agile and quick on his feet. This matchup will be a battle of contrasting styles, as Davis relies on his strength and athleticism while Towns utilizes his finesse and versatility. The outcome of this clash will likely have a significant impact on the overall flow of the game. 
- 
D'Angelo Russell vs. Mike Conley: The point guard battle will be crucial in dictating the pace and flow of the game. Russell's scoring ability and playmaking skills will be pitted against Conley's experience and leadership. Russell's ability to penetrate the defense and create scoring opportunities for himself and his teammates will be essential to the Lakers' offensive success. Conley's composure and decision-making will be crucial in controlling the tempo of the game and preventing turnovers. This matchup will be a test of both offensive firepower and defensive resilience, as each player seeks to outmaneuver the other and lead their team to victory. 
X-Factors
For the Lakers, Austin Reaves needs to continue his stellar playmaking and shooting. His ability to knock down crucial shots and make smart decisions with the ball will be vital in supporting LeBron and AD. Reaves has proven to be a reliable option in clutch moments, and his confidence and poise under pressure will be valuable assets for the Lakers. His ability to create opportunities for himself and his teammates will be crucial in keeping the Timberwolves' defense honest and preventing them from focusing solely on LeBron and AD. Reaves' contribution will be a key factor in determining the Lakers' success in this series.
For the Timberwolves, Jaden McDaniels’ defensive intensity and ability to hit open shots will be key. If he can provide consistent scoring and lock down defensively, it will take pressure off Edwards and Towns. McDaniels' defensive versatility allows him to guard multiple positions effectively, disrupting the Lakers' offensive flow and forcing them into uncomfortable situations. His ability to knock down open shots will punish the Lakers for leaving him unguarded and create more space for Edwards and Towns to operate. McDaniels' all-around contribution will be essential to the Timberwolves' chances of pulling off an upset.
Prediction
This series is going to be a hard-fought battle, no doubt. The Lakers' experience and star power make them the favorites, but the Timberwolves' youth and athleticism cannot be overlooked. I’m leaning towards the Lakers taking Game 1, but it will be a close one. Expect a high-scoring affair with both teams pushing the pace. LeBron and AD will assert their dominance, but Anthony Edwards will keep the Timberwolves within striking distance. Ultimately, the Lakers' playoff experience and ability to execute in crucial moments will give them the edge.
Lakers win Game 1 by 5 points.
